We stayed in Venice Times Hotel for two nights and think that we made a good choice. Our first experience of Venice is crowd. There are so many people walking in the narrow alleys with pebble road. Unlike the other cities in Europe that taxi can deliver you right in front of hotel, most people arrived in Venice through rail, bus or air and the closest point to the city is S. Lucia. It is not uncommon to see people carrying their luggage walking around in Venice. The Venice Times Hotel is very close to the railway station and you do not have to carry you luggage over the bridges that are one of the symbols of Venice. In addition, you do not have to endure the bad smells of some waterways. The staff is very helpful and always ready to help. We got detailed explanations of Venice and suggestions of sightseeing the city when we checked in. The room though small is clean and comfortable. It is understandable space is limited in Venice. Located in Cannaregio, The Venice Times is adjacent to Chiesa di Santa Maria di Nazareth and within a 5-minute walk of other popular sights like Scalzi Bridge. Each of the 30 rooms at this 4.5-star hotel includes an electric kettle, an LCD TV, and free tea bags/instant coffee.


Dining

For your convenience, a buffet breakfast is served for a fee each morning from 7:00 AM to 10:30 AM. At the end of the day, the bar/lounge is a great place to grab a drink.


Rooms

Guests can expect free WiFi and 42-inch LCD TVs with satellite channels. Beds are dressed in premium bedding and down comforters, and bathrooms offer hair dryers and free toiletries. Electric kettles, laptop-compatible safes, and phones are other standard amenities.


Property features

Guests staying at The Venice Times enjoy free WiFi in public areas, free newspapers, and a garden. The 24-hour front desk has multilingual staff ready to assist with securing valuables, concierge services, and luggage storage.
